eyerighteye · June 29, 2018, 4:30 p.m.

The libertarian Non Aggression Principal

Simply stated my rights end where another's begin.

I have the absolute right to do as I please as long as it harms no one but me. We all have this right.

No one, not you not me not the government or the UN have the right to use force, coersion, or any other form of aggression to force anyone to do anything.

Defence of rights is allowed of course.
